在这个数字化时代,网页已经成为人们获取信息、交流互动的重要平台。一个美观、实用的网页能够给用户留下深刻印象。而个性化网页特效则是提升网页吸引力的重要手段。jQuery作为一款优秀的JavaScript库,可以轻松实现各种网页特效。下面,我将带你一步步学会jQuery,并打造独一无二的个性化网页特效。
了解jQuery
1. 什么是jQuery?
j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了JavaScript的开发过程,使开发者能够更方便地实现各种网页特效。
2. jQuery的特点
- 跨平台:jQuery可以在各种浏览器上运行,包括IE6、IE7、IE8、Firefox、Safari、Chrome等。
- 轻量级:jQuery的文件大小仅为31KB,压缩后仅为19KB。
- 简洁的语法:jQuery提供了一系列简洁的API,使得开发者可以轻松地实现各种功能。
- 丰富的插件:jQuery拥有大量的插件,可以满足各种需求。
入门jQuery
1. 安装jQuery
首先,你需要下载jQuery库。可以从官方网站(https://jquery.com/)下载最新版本的jQuery库。下载完成后,将jQuery库文件引入到你的HTML文件中。
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
2. 基本语法
jQuery的基本语法如下:
$(document).ready(function(){
// jQuery代码
});
这个语法表示在文档加载完成后执行内部的代码。
3. 选择器
jQuery提供了丰富的选择器,可以方便地选择元素。以下是一些常用的选择器:
- ID选择器:
$("#id") - 类选择器:
.class - 标签选择器:
$("div") - 属性选择器:
$("[name='value'])"
网页特效实战
1. 动画效果
使用jQuery实现动画效果非常简单。以下是一个示例:
$(document).ready(function(){
$("#button").click(function(){
$("#div").animate({left: '250px'}, "slow");
});
});
这段代码表示当点击按钮时,将div元素的left属性从初始位置移动到250px的位置。
2. 弹出框
使用jQuery实现弹出框效果:
$(document).ready(function(){
$("#button").click(function(){
alert("点击了按钮!");
});
});
这段代码表示当点击按钮时,会弹出一个包含“点击了按钮!”文本的对话框。
3. 表单验证
使用jQuery实现表单验证:
$(document).ready(function(){
$("#form").submit(function(){
if($("#username").val() == "" || $("#password").val() == ""){
alert("用户名和密码不能为空!");
return false;
}
return true;
});
});
这段代码表示在提交表单时,如果用户名或密码为空,则弹出提示框并阻止表单提交。
打造个性化网页特效
1. 创意设计
在网页特效的设计上,要注重创意。可以根据网站的主题和风格,设计独特的动画效果、弹出框等。
2. 用户体验
网页特效要注重用户体验,避免过度使用,以免影响网站性能。
3. 优化代码
在编写jQuery代码时,要注意代码的优化,以提高网站性能。
通过以上内容,相信你已经对jQuery有了初步的了解,并且能够实现一些基本的网页特效。在今后的开发过程中,不断积累经验,你会打造出更多独一无二的个性化网页特效。
